9a131ec8ad19e585fee45c5f281b589e03ab70423744f71feb99a4347be42a03

1338541 (466209 blocks ago)

⏴ Block 1338540 (058e1203...e22) | Block 1338542 ⏵ | Latest block ⏭

Metadata

6/7/23, 6:04 PM UTC (647d 12:19:17 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details